Admission to the college is conducted through the DMER online process via NEET, with candidates needing to take the NEET exam. The selection process includes about three rounds, potentially followed by a mop-up and an institutional round. The faculty is highly qualified with master's and PhD degrees, known for being experienced and supportive. The Bachelor of Dental Surgery (BDS) program includes comprehensive assessments, with about 90% of students passing annually, and exams perceived as moderately challenging.
The college's fee structure is the lowest in Pune but still considered expensive. The annual fee is approximately 224,000 INR, with scholarships such as the EBC scholarship offering a 50% fee reimbursement for minority students, significantly easing financial strain. Additionally, the RAJARSHRI CHHATRAPATI SHAHU MAHARAJ FEE REIMBURSEMENT scheme offers further financial relief for eligible students, including a 50% fee reduction for OBC students. The college provides robust job opportunities, including a one-year internship and externship with a high patient load, which offers substantial practice but no stipend for interns.
The internship program is considered superior due to the high number of patients.
